English language teacher leaders attend ESL Summer Academy at UMaine

English learner educators from twenty-five school districts participated in the ESL Summer Academy at UMaine in Orono where participants engaged in activities to facilitate professional development planning based on the needs of their schools and districts. This valuable training supports educators as they become in-house facilitators, building capacity within districts to develop all teachers into teachers of English language to further support the needs of all students.

The Department received numerous comments on the great value of the academy and the benefit of credits for recertification being provided. One teacher wrote “I am grateful for this opportunity. I am the only ESL teacher in our district and therefore, I work in isolation. I need to come and learn, and network. I am now energized about the next school year.”  The three-day ESL Summer Academy is offered annually through the University of Maine and will take place in 2017 from June 26-28.
